46,489,015,612,489
Forty-six trillion, four hundred and eighty-nine billion, fifteen million, six hundred and twelve thousand, four hundred and eighty-nine.
Barcode
Odd
46489015612489 is odd
Previous odd number is 46489015612487
Next odd number is 46489015612491